Here’s a full walkthrough on how to draw Princess Peach from The Super Mario Bros. Movie. The version in the movie sticks close to her game design, but with a few slight updates to the face and posture. The drawing is split into 21 steps. It’s a full-body pose, not overly complex, but the hair and dress folds require a bit of attention.
What to Focus on While Drawing
- Waist-length honey blonde hair with large side bangs and full volume
- Crown with detailed jewels and soft spikes
- Large blue eyes and long eyebrows
- Round sky-blue earrings
- Pink dress with layered details and a cyan gem on her chest
- Long white gloves
- Dress with draping fabric across the waist and lower folds
- Neutral stance with arms folded in front

Understanding the Drawing Format
- Red Color: highlights the current step you’re working on
- Black Color: shows what has already been drawn in previous steps
- Grey Color: marks the initial sketch used for proportions and layout
The structure follows a clean breakdown from basic form to full detail.
